MATCH() takes 3 parameters, the last (Type) being optional. Built-in description only says Type can be -1, 0 or 1, without explaining what any of those modes do, and without informing that 1 is the default (and it usually is NOT the mode user wants to use, but it's been default since forever). The behavior of this function is described here: https://help.libreoffice.org/Calc/Spreadsheet_Functions#MATCH . IMHO this description should be copied into Calc.

What is also worrying is that on small datasets, MATCH() works "properly" (Type=0) independently of what Type is actually set to. See attached screencast. It is quite confusing, but we may need to leave it as-is to preserve compatibility.
